The Academy of Adventure Gaming Arts & Design (AAGAD) is a peer based network of gaming industry professionals whose mission is to promote innovation and excellence in design and production of games and game related materials.
The Origins Awards were presented for the first time at the very first Origins Game Fair in Baltimore in 1975. The purpose of the awards is to recognize excellence in game design, and increase awareness and sales for the nominees, winners, the Origins convention, and hobby games in general.
Any publisher or designer can submit their products for consideration during the eligibility period. Submissions in each category are evaluated by a jury of industry professionals who choose their top products. These become the nominees, which are sent to the Academy of Adventure Gaming Arts & Design. The Academy places their votes by email and the winners are announced during the Awards ceremony.
During the show, attendees also have the opportunity to examine and even play the nominated titles in the Nominee Showcase Area, sponsored by Game Toppers. They are encouraged to vote for their Fan Favorite in each category, the winners of which are also announced during the Awards ceremony.
Category | Game | Company | Designers/Artist |
Best Board Game Game of the Year |
Tiny Towns | Alderac Entertainment Group | Peter McPherson, Gong Studios, Matt Paquette |
Best Card Game | Point Salad | Alderac Entertainment Group | Molly Johnson, Robert Melvin, Shawn Stankewich, Dylan Mangini |
Best Family Game | The Quacks of Quedlinburg | North Star Games | Wolfgang Warsch, Dennis Lohausen |
Digital Adaptation | Tsuro VR | Calliope Games / Thunderbox Entertainment Digital | Tom McMurchie |
Best Collectible Game | Marvel HeroClix: Avengers Black Panther and the Illuminati Booster Brick | WizKids | |
Best Role-Playing Game | Teens in Space | Renegade Game Studios | Jonathan Gilmour, Doug Levandowski |
Best Game Accessory | Citadel Contrast Paint | Games Workshop | |
Best Miniatures Game | Warcry | Games Workshop | The Warhammer Studio |
Best Historical Miniatures Game | Bolt Action: Campaign D-Day Operation Overlord | Osprey Games / Warlord Games | Robert Vella, Peter Dennis |
Best Historical Game | Pandemic: Fall of Rome | Z-Man Games | Matt Leacock, Paolo Mori, Atha Kanaani, Olly Lawson, Antonio Maínez |
